Victor Hedman Named 11th LightningCaptain



By Jake Ricker


The Tampa Bay Lightning have officially named Victor Hedman their 11th captain in franchise history.


It doesn't come as much of a surprise that Hedman will wear the C for the Lightning after previous captain Stamkos signed with the Nashville Predators in the offseason. Hedman, just like Stamkos, has been with the Lightning since day one and has been an Alternate captain since the 2014-2015 season. Hedman is a cornerstone of the Lightning organization, and this move only furthers his spot in Lightning history.


In 15 seasons with the Lightning, Hedman has played in over 1,000 games with 156 goals, 572 assists, and 728 points. Hedman is the franchise leader among defencemen in goals, assists, points, +/-, and 1st in GWG. He also will pass Stamkos in GP this upcoming season.
